#include <stdio.h>
// Foundation.h我們稱之為主頭文件, 主頭文件中又拷貝了該工具箱中所有工具的頭文件, 我們只需要導入主頭文件就可以使用該工具箱中所有的工具, 避免了每次使用都要導入一個對應的頭文件
// 工具箱的地址: /Applications/Xcode.app/Contents/Developer/Platforms/iPhoneOS.platform/Developer/SDKs/iPhoneOS.sdk/System/Library/Frameworks
// 規(guī)律: 所有的主頭文件的名稱都和工具箱的名稱一致
// 所有的主頭文件都是導入了該工具箱中所有工具的頭文件
#import <Foundation/Foundation.h>
#import <Foundation/Foundation.h>
#import <Foundation/Foundation.h>
#import <Foundation/Foundation.h>
/*
import 的功能和 include一樣, 是將右邊的文件拷貝到當前import的位置
為了降低程序員的負擔, 防止重復導入, 避免程序員去書寫 頭文件衛(wèi)士, 那么OC給出來一個新的預處理指令import
import優(yōu)點: 會自動防止重復拷貝
*/
/*
因為OC完全兼容C, 所以可以在OC程序中編寫C語言代碼
并且可以將C語言的源文件和OC的源文件組合在一起生成可執(zhí)行文件
*/
#import "zs.h"
int main(int argc, const char * argv[]) {
// 1.OC是兼容C的
printf("c hello world\n");
printf("c hello world\n");
/*
printf和NSLog的區(qū)別:
NSLog會自動換行
NSLog在輸出內(nèi)容時會附加一些系統(tǒng)信息
NSLog和printf接收的參數(shù)不一樣
*/
NSLog(@"OC hello World");
NSLog(@"OC hello World");
NSLog(@"sum = %i", sum(20, 10));
return 0;
}
02-01朱躺、第一個OC程序
最后編輯于 :
?著作權歸作者所有,轉(zhuǎn)載或內(nèi)容合作請聯(lián)系作者
- 文/潘曉璐 我一進店門抛蚁,熙熙樓的掌柜王于貴愁眉苦臉地迎上來,“玉大人栖茉,你說我怎么就攤上這事篮绿。” “怎么了吕漂?”我有些...
- 文/不壞的土叔 我叫張陵亲配,是天一觀的道長。 經(jīng)常有香客問我惶凝,道長吼虎,這世上最難降的妖魔是什么? 我笑而不...
- 正文 為了忘掉前任苍鲜,我火速辦了婚禮思灰,結果婚禮上,老公的妹妹穿的比我還像新娘混滔。我一直安慰自己洒疚,他們只是感情好,可當我...
- 文/花漫 我一把揭開白布坯屿。 她就那樣靜靜地躺著油湖,像睡著了一般。 火紅的嫁衣襯著肌膚如雪领跛。 梳的紋絲不亂的頭發(fā)上乏德,一...
- 文/蒼蘭香墨 我猛地睜開眼,長吁一口氣:“原來是場噩夢啊……” “哼蘑拯!你這毒婦竟也來了劫拢?” 一聲冷哼從身側(cè)響起,我...
- 正文 年R本政府宣布,位于F島的核電站浓领,受9級特大地震影響玉凯,放射性物質(zhì)發(fā)生泄漏。R本人自食惡果不足惜联贩,卻給世界環(huán)境...
- 文/蒙蒙 一漫仆、第九天 我趴在偏房一處隱蔽的房頂上張望。 院中可真熱鬧泪幌,春花似錦盲厌、人聲如沸。這莊子的主人今日做“春日...
- 文/蒼蘭香墨 我抬頭看了看天上的太陽。三九已至浴滴,卻和暖如春拓萌,著一層夾襖步出監(jiān)牢的瞬間,已是汗流浹背升略。 一陣腳步聲響...